The Basics of Image Effects

Before we jump into the tutorial, let's start with the basics of image effects. In a photo editing application like Photoshop or GIMP, images are typically separated into layers, with the foreground and background being the most common layers. Additional layers can be created for more advanced effects. Once the image is divided into layers, it is brought into a video editing application, where the movement of a virtual camera is simulated using techniques such as scaling, panning, and distortion. These techniques give the illusion of depth and make the image come alive.

Steps for Creating a 2.5D Photo Effect

Now, let's get into the step-by-step process of creating a 2.5D photo effect. Here's an overview of the steps we'll be covering:

  1. Separating the Image into Layers: In a photo editing application, we'll separate the image into at least two layers: foreground and background. Additional layers can be added for more complex effects.
  2. Bringing the Layers into a Video Editing Application: We'll import the multi-layer image into a video editing application, such as Final Cut Pro X, to simulate camera movement.
  3. Simulating Camera Movement: Through animation, we'll create the illusion of a real-world camera by animating changes in Scale, position, and distortion. This will give the image depth and a Sense of movement.
  4. Distortion Techniques: We can use various techniques, such as panning, zooming, and orbiting, to create different types of camera movements and visual effects.
  5. Choosing the Right Image for the Effect: It's essential to select an image with suitable resolution and elements that lend themselves well to the 2.5D effect.
  6. Breaking Apart the Image into Layers: We'll learn how to separate the image into its different layers, ensuring transparency where needed.
  7. Cleaning up the Foreground Layer: We'll use tools like the magic Wand or the fuzzy select tool to clean up the foreground layer, removing any unnecessary elements or imperfections.
  8. Creating the Background Layer: We'll duplicate the original layer and create the background layer, ensuring it does not have transparency.
  9. Filling in the Background Hole: We'll fill in any areas of the background layer that need to be exposed during the animation process.
  10. Finishing Touches and Animation: We'll set animation parameters such as zoom, pan, and duration to bring the image to life and fine-tune the overall effect.

FAQ:

Q: Can I achieve the 2.5D photo effect with other software? A: Yes, you can achieve the 2.5D photo effect with various software that supports layers and animation. The specific settings and tools may differ, but the overall concept remains the same.

Q: Is it necessary to use high-resolution images for this effect? A: While using high-resolution images can provide better results, it's not always necessary. It's essential to consider the balance between image quality and the performance of your editing and animation process. You can always scale down high-resolution images to a more manageable size if needed.
